1878 York by-election
The York by-election of 1878 was a by-election held in England on 20 February 1878 for the House of Commons constituency of York. The byelection was held due to the incumbent Conservative MP, James Lowther, becoming Chief Secretary for Ireland. It was retained by the incumbent.
